Research interest
Research focused on Cancer research and Endoplasmic reticulum, with related work in Neuroinflammation, Unfolded protein response, Triple-negative breast cancer. Notable publications include 'microRNA-497 Modulates Breast Cancer Cell Proliferation, Invasion, and Survival by Targeting SMAD7', 'MiR-340 Inhibits Triple-Negative Breast Cancer Progression by Reversing EZH2 Mediated miRNAs Dysregulated Expressions', and 'Modulating endoplasmic reticulum stress in APP/PS1 mice by Gomisin B and Osthole in Bushen-Yizhi formula: Synergistic effects and therapeutic implications for Alzheimer's disease'.
